Solution for 8x-(4x-4)=28 equation:


Simplifying
8x + -1(4x + -4) = 28

Reorder the terms:
8x + -1(-4 + 4x) = 28
8x + (-4 * -1 + 4x * -1) = 28
8x + (4 + -4x) = 28

Reorder the terms:
4 + 8x + -4x = 28

Combine like terms: 8x + -4x = 4x
4 + 4x = 28

Solving
4 + 4x = 28

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-4' to each side of the equation.
4 + -4 + 4x = 28 + -4

Combine like terms: 4 + -4 = 0
0 + 4x = 28 + -4
4x = 28 + -4

Combine like terms: 28 + -4 = 24
4x = 24

Divide each side by '4'.
x = 6

Simplifying
x = 6
